RE: Scope of Services and Fee Proposal


Brazos County Medical Examiner Office
Project # 18-64

Dear Mr. Wendt:

The office of PGAL is pleased to present this scope of work and fee proposal for the
design of the Brazos County Medical Examiner Office in Bryan, Texas. In previous
studies, the County has determined that their need is for an approximately 16,000
sq. ft. facility at an approximate total project cost of $22 million. The project will be
funded by American Rescue Plan Act of 2021 (ARPA) funds received by the County.

The desired site is an approximately 11-acre site on 29th street between Broadmoor
and Briarcrest. The site is expected to be large enough to accommodate a second
future County facility.

PGAL, MWL and our A/E team, along with our consultant Dr. Kathryn Pinneri, M. D.,
will work closely with the County and any other stakeholders to determine the
ultimate size, floor plan layout, exterior and interior design of your new facility. This
same team recently completed the Montgomery County Forensic Center for Dr.
Pinneri. Since Brazos County does not currently have a medical examiner, Dr.
Pinneri’s expertise can help lead the team to a design solution that will be able to
both meet the needs of the county and surrounding areas, accommodate potential
learning opportunities for nearby Texas A&M medical and forensic and investigative
science programs, and ultimately attract potential permanent medical examiner
candidates.

PROJECT UNDERSTANDING
The design team’s scope of work will include confirmation of departmental space
requirements, Conceptual Design, Schematic Design, Design Development and
Construction Document design phases, assistance with the bidding process, and
Construction Administration throughout the construction phase. These services
will be provided by our PGAL team and our consultants as follows:

SCOPE OF WORK

The scope of work anticipated includes the following:

PROGRAM VERIFICATION AND CONCEPT DESIGN

The initial program verification and concept design phase will determine overall
building size and configuration and test several options for building location on the
County’s site. Going through the program verification stage, our team will review
the previous studies done for the project and put the information into a format that
we can utilize to create floor plans showing the layout of furnishings and
equipment. Once a site plan has been approved, our geotechnical engineer will
perform geotechnical investigation and prepare a report outlining foundation and
paving recommendations.

FINAL DESIGN

In the final design phase of the work PGAL and the A/E team will complete the
construction documents for bidding/pricing and provide construction administration
services through the completion of the project. The final design phase will consist
of Schematic Design, Design Development and Construction Document phases.
Our basic services consultants for the project will provide, civil engineering,
structural engineering, mechanical electrical and plumbing engineering. Additional
specialty consulting services are listed separately, which include our M. D.
consultant, Dr. Kathryn Pinneri, landscape architecture, security,
telecommunications, audio/visual, furniture design, and environmental
graphics/signage design. As part of basic services for the final design phase, MWL
will select and specify the autopsy equipment, provide an equipment manual for
County review, and provide drawings and specifications for it to be bid out as part of
the construction document package. Detailed cost estimates will be performed
after the initial programming and concept design phase, at the end of Design
Development and at 50% and 95% Construction Documents to ensure that the
project is being designed to your budget. It is anticipated that documentation will
be provided for the buildout of all spaces in the building, and that the County will
be issuing Requests for Proposal (RFPs) from general contractors..

CONSTRUCTION ADMINISTRATION

During construction, PGAL and our consultants will provide Construction


Administration Services, which include responding to requests for information
(RFIs), reviewing submittals, attending on-site project meetings, making periodic site
observations, and reviewing contractor pay applications and change proposals. We
have included materials testing for soil preparation, concrete, steel reinforcement
and structural steel observation and testing. We and our consultants will also
perform a final site observation and create a punch list of items to be finalized. We
will be available for on-site meetings and construction observation at key points in
construction, for the initial concrete slab pour, wall and ceiling cover up
observations, and preconstruction / pre-installation meetings.

COMPENSATION

We have provided a lump sum fee for design services. The overall Basic Services fee
is as follows:

Basic Services:

• Subtotal Basic Services $1,308,870


• Profit $ 145,430
• Total Basic Services $1,454,300

Additional Specialty Consulting Services:

The following is a list of additional services are optional to the project (except for
those noted below as being code required) and are beyond the scope of the basic
services listed above. Though we have broken out these additional consultants and
services separately should the County decide to obtain these services separately
from this design contract, we and our consultant team are fully capable of providing
each service.

Base Fee Profit Total Fee


• Dr. Kathryn Pinneri, M. D. $ 45,000 $ 5,000 $ 50,000
• Landscape Architecture $ 27,000 $ 3,000 $ 30,000
• IECC Commissioning (Code Req.) $ 27,000 $ 3,000 $ 30,000
• Telecommunications Consulting $ 22,113 $ 2,457 $ 24,570
• Security Consulting $ 13,267.80 $ 1,474.20 $ 14,742
• Audio/Visual Consulting $ 8,845.20 $ 982.80 $ 9,828
• Furniture Selection, Design, Spec. $ 45,000 $ 5,000 $ 50,000
• Environ. Graphics / Signage $ 13,500 $ 1,500 $ 15,000
• Geotechnical Engineering $ 19,350 $ 2,150 $ 21,500
• Construction Materials Testing $ 45,000 $ 5,000 $ 50,000
• Cost Estimating $ 29,466 $ 3,274 $ 32,740
